AbstractC4A3 hydration, the mechanism of C4A3 expansion, ettringite formation and its thermal stability are examined in a 3-part study. In this part, the amount of ettringite formed and the C4A3 degree of hydration are interrelated, and correlated with the degree of expansion beyond an induction period for the initiation of expansion. Effects of hydration temperature are examined. Finally, phase equilibria describing ettringite stability are determined as a function of pressure.
